如何在debian中安装与卸载服务程序

如何在debian中安装与卸载服务程序,第1张

修改debian的更新源为163源,当然也可以用其他源,此处以163源为例。修改/etc/apt/sources.list

更新软件列表:apt-get update

安装软件:apt-get install package,package为软件名称,可以通过apt-get search package从列表中查找软件包,通过添加参数--reinstall 重新安装包

修复安装:apt-get -f install

删除包:apt-get remove package,可以加--purge参数删除配置文件等

更新已安装的包:apt-get upgrade

升级系统:apt-get dist-upgrade,另外可使用 dselect 升级,apt-get dselect-upgrade

了解使用依赖:apt-cache depends package,可通过apt-cache rdepends package 查看该包被哪些包依赖

安装相关的编译环境:apt-get build-dep package

下载该包的源代码:apt-get source package

清理无用的包:apt-get clean 或 apt-get autoclean

检查是否有损坏的依赖:apt-get check

获取包的相关信息,如说明、大小、版本等:apt-cache show package

一、如果是安装版虚拟光驱可以到控制面板里面的“添加或删除程序”卸载虚拟光驱,重启就好了。

二、其它的可以通过如下方法把多余的虚拟光驱禁用掉或者卸载。

1、按住快捷键WIN+R;

2、打开运行输入compmgmt.msc回车;

3、在窗口中选择“磁盘管理”;

4、这是光盘驱动器盘符;

5、右击要删除的光驱盘符,选择更改驱动器号和路径;

6、在d出的窗口中,单机删除按钮,选择“是”即可删除该无效驱动器盘符,确定保存。

第一种:通过安装源安装的软件

1、安装软件 apt-get install softname

2、删除软件包,但是不删除软件的配置文件:(如果再想安装,可能会出现问题)

apt-get remove softname

复制

3、删除软件包,并删除相应的配置文件:(apt-get autoremove softname将依赖的软件包卸载掉,这样就可以完全卸载一个软件)

apt-get remove --purge softname

复制

4、可以用 softname -V来检查是否卸载完成

5、更新软件信息数据库 :

apt-get update

6、进行系统升级 :

apt-get upgrade

7、搜索软件包:

apt-cache search

第二种:使用下载的.deb包安装的软件

1、安装deb软件包

命令: dpkg -i xxx.deb

2、删除软件包

命令: dpkg -r xxx.deb

3、连同配置文件一起删除

命令: dpkg -r –purge xxx.deb

4、查看软件包信息

命令: dpkg -info xxx.deb

5、查看文件拷贝详情

命令: dpkg -L xxx.deb

6、查看系统中已安装软件包信息

命令: dpkg -l

第三种也是最麻烦的一种(使用make install 安装的软件,所以这里不建议使用这种安装方式)

1、如果真有的需要(添加–prefix)(这样会把安装文件安装到你自己配置的文件中):

./configure --prefix=/usr/local/<your_filename>&&make install

复制

2、如果没有配置–prefix选项,源码包也没有提供make uninstall,则可以通过以下方式可以完整卸载:

找一个临时目录重新安装一遍,如:

./configure --prefix=/tmp/to_remove &&make install

复制

然后遍历/tmp/to_remove的文件,删除对应安装位置的文件即可(因为/tmp/to_remove里的目录结构就是没有配置–prefix选项时的目录结构)。


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/yw/12134446.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-21
下一篇 2023-05-21

发表评论

登录后才能评论

评论列表(0条)

保存